A detailed study of three key aspects that have come to define the UN's presence in Haiti – the use of force, sexual exploitation and abuse, and an epidemic inadvertently introduced by UN peacekeepers – combining international relations with international law and suggesting a new model of accountability which foregrounds human rights.
